Automotive Non-Woven Fabrics Market Overview:

Drivers:

One of the primary drivers fueling the growth of the Automotive Non-Woven Fabrics Market is the automotive industry's emphasis on reducing vehicle weight to enhance fuel efficiency and meet stringent emission regulations. Non-woven fabrics, known for their lightweight and strength properties, are being adopted extensively in the automotive sector to replace traditional materials like textiles and plastics. This helps automakers achieve weight reduction goals without compromising on safety and performance.

Additionally, the rising consumer demand for enhanced interior comfort, noise reduction, and aesthetics is driving the use of non-woven fabrics in automotive interiors. Non-woven materials contribute to improved acoustics, thermal insulation, and soft-touch surfaces, enhancing the overall driving experience.

Trends:

An emerging trend in the Automotive Non-Woven Fabrics Market is the development of sustainable and eco-friendly materials. As environmental concerns gain prominence, automakers are seeking non-woven fabric solutions made from recycled or biodegradable materials. This trend aligns with the industry's commitment to reducing its carbon footprint and adopting circular economy principles.

Moreover, the integration of smart and connected features in vehicles is spurring innovation in non-woven fabric applications. Non-woven fabrics are being used to house sensors, wiring, and other electronic components, supporting the growth of connected and autonomous vehicles.

Restraints:

One of the key challenges hindering the growth of the Automotive Non-Woven Fabrics Market is the cost of production. While non-woven fabrics offer numerous benefits, including lightweighting and customization, their production can be relatively expensive compared to conventional materials. Achieving cost competitiveness while maintaining product quality remains a challenge for manufacturers.

Furthermore, the availability of alternative lightweight materials, such as composites and advanced plastics, poses competition to non-woven fabrics. Automakers must carefully evaluate material options to optimize cost and performance.

Automotive Non-Woven Fabrics Market Segmentation By Application:

The market is segmented based on application into:

  1. Interior: Automotive non-woven fabrics find extensive use in interior applications, including seat upholstery, carpeting, headliners, and door panels.
  2. Exterior: Exterior applications may include underbody shields, wheel arch liners, and other components where non-woven materials provide durability and protection.

Automotive Non-Woven Fabrics Market Segmentation By Type:

Automotive non-woven fabrics can be categorized into:

  1. Polypropylene: Polypropylene-based non-woven fabrics are known for their strength, durability, and resistance to moisture, making them suitable for various automotive applications.
  2. Polyester: Polyester non-woven fabrics offer excellent thermal and chemical resistance, making them ideal for interior and exterior applications.
  3. Nylon: Nylon-based non-woven fabrics are valued for their abrasion resistance and versatility in automotive use.
  4. Others: This category encompasses various other non-woven fabric types tailored to specific automotive requirements.

Major Automotive Non-Woven Fabrics Companies:

Companies in the automotive non-woven fabrics market offer a range of materials and solutions to support lightweighting and interior comfort goals.

Example companies include:

  1. Freudenberg Group: Freudenberg provides non-woven fabrics for automotive interiors, including headliners, carpeting, and door panels.
  2. Lydall Inc.: Lydall offers thermal and acoustical solutions using non-woven materials for vehicle insulation and noise reduction.
  3. DuPont: DuPont specializes in advanced non-woven materials used in automotive applications, including air and fuel filtration.
